Engineering Manager

About the Role

As an Engineering Manager at NetActuate, you will play a pivotal role in managing and building our agile-based engineering team. You will work closely with the leadership team, including the CEO, and directly manage a team of 5-8 engineers, with the potential to hire more as needed.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in working with and building agile-based engineering teams for SAAS services. They should be proficient in PHP, Python, and JavaScript, and have a solid understanding of Linux, APIs, web services, and networking.

Responsibilities

  • Act as the scrum manager for the engineering team, overseeing s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ives.
  • Create user stories, tasks, and engineering documents to guide the development process.
  • Assist with architectural decisions and provide technical guidance to the team.
  • Lead by example and remain hands-on in the development process, contributing to mult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Manage backend services (daemons), API layer projects, and frontend portals.
  • Implement modern CI/CD principles, including pipelines, workflows, and QA integration.
  • Foster a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ement within the engineering team.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ure successful project delivery and alignment with business objectives.

Requirements

  • 4+ Years of Experience
  • Proven experience managing and building agile-based engineering teams for SAAS services, delivering products from start to finish.
  • Strong proficiency in PHP, Python, and JavaScript.
  • Solid understanding of Linux, APIs, web services, and networking.
  • Familiarity and comfort with microservices, containers, and virtualization.
  • Experience with modern CI/CD principles and tools.
  • Excellent communication and leadership sk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
  • Previous experience working in a smaller/startup environment is preferred.

Benefits

  • Full-time employment with 401k benefits.
  • Salary commensurate with experience and market rates.
  • Hybrid work model: In-office at least 3 days a week.
